John Greig and John McClelland have stepped down from their roles as non-executive directors at Rangers.
The news comes just days after the appointment of Craig Whyte as the new chairman at the club and it is this development that is understood to have persuaded the duo to leave.
A statement released on behalf of both Greig and McClelland read, "These resignations have been communicated by letter to the chairman, Craig Whyte. Both were of the opinion that since the change of ownership they have been excluded from participating in corporate governance at the club."
Greig is a former Rangers player while McClelland was chairman at the club for two years in the early 2000s.
